Default starter motor adjustment

Having trouble with the starter and a TCI flexplate on a 2002 TransAm. The starter drive gear hangs up in the flexplate ring gear and the drive gear bushing wears out which results in a loud whine. Of course, now the Bendix drive gear is trashed and needs to be replaced. Before I ruin another one, does anyone know the correct adjustment for the drive gear to ring gear? On older Chevys, it is around .020" clearance between the top surface of the drive gear tooth and the valley in the ring gear. Could not find anything in the '02 GM shop manual other than "add shims to eliminate the noise".
